Object Detection

Many robot vacuums robot are entangled in cords, socks and pet toys while trying to clean carpeted surfaces. This is why it's crucial to remove these areas prior to you start the robot cleaner. The top models feature obstacle detection to help with this. This technology uses sensors to identify large obstacles and then move around them, preventing the robot from hitting them or breaking them. This saves you time by not having to put away socks, shoes and cords before you start cleaning, and also stops the robot from getting caught in these objects.

Most robots use multiple sensors to determine the location of their space and how to move around it. Some robots employ both mapping and localization simultaneously, using a laser map of the floor, while sensors determine their current location within the space. This allows them to understand the position of their feet in relation to the room layout even when furniture is moved. Others use 3D Time of Flight (ToF) Technology, which measures the way light reflects off objects to create a 3D model of the space. This provides them with an extremely high-resolution view of the space, but they may not be as precise in detecting thin or transparent obstacles.

Self-Emptying

Outsourcing vacuuming to a robot can save you time and make your floors look better than what you could do on your own. One of the disadvantages of robotic vacuums is that they gather more debris with each trip. This means their dust bins are filled faster. Self-emptying robot vacuums are the answer. They store the accumulated dirt in a larger storage compartment located in the robot's charging dock. It is possible to empty the compartments a few time a month.

The size of the robot's bin also determines how often you'll need to change its dust bag and it's worth looking for a model with a large capacity. Some models can keep dust for up to two weeks, which can make maintenance easier.

Many robot vacuums with self-emptying features also come with mopping features. The majority of robot mops, in contrast to their vacuum counterparts have front-loading tanks that allow users to easily clean and air dry mopping pads that are dirty between uses.

In addition to being simple to maintain mops are perfect for dealing with sticky spills and food-related messes that traditional vacuums don't always manage to. Certain robot vacuums make loud noises during the operation, so it's essential to choose a model that comes with an optional quiet mode. In the absence of this, your robot could disrupt family conversations or be a distraction while you relax.

It's recommended to read the product description carefully and look for a specific specification, such as "Pa." This measurement relates to how much pressure, or suction, the robot can create on a floor surface. You'll require more of a Pa rating for floors that are hard and a lower rating if your floor is carpeted. It's important to search for a battery longevity that lasts at least a couple of hours between charges. This is particularly true if the vacuum will be used for quick cleaning or if your floor is often covered with dirt and crumbs.
